One injured person discharged after school attack in Fagersta, suspect in custody

A boy, said to be between 12 and 17 years old, was slightly injured but was able to go home after treatment on Friday, according to the patient injury report from Region Västmanland.

Two more people, also boys between the ages of 12 and 17, are seriously injured but are said to be in stable condition. One of them underwent emergency surgery on Friday.

An 18-year-old perpetrator has been arrested and police confirm that shots were fired during the arrest. However, it is unclear whether the perpetrator was injured, according to police. He is being held in custody and is not being treated in hospital. Prosecutor Ann-Sofi Trossing does not yet want to say whether the 18-year-old has made any admissions.

There is intensive investigative work underway with interrogations and gathering information, but I do not want to go into more detail about what we have done, says Ann-Sofie Trossing.

One person was killed in the attack. The person was found when police entered the school to secure the premises. There is no information on the gender or age of the deceased.

"We cannot provide any more information at this time out of consideration for the relatives and the preliminary investigation," says Stefan Larsson, police spokesperson.

The police are currently interviewing witnesses and will also be on site in Fagersta and the surrounding area.

A massive amount of work is currently underway.
